Marketing veteran joins WMEP to help manufacturers find new ways to grow

MILWAUKEE – The Wisconsin Manufacturing Extension Partnership (WMEP) has hired a marketing veteran to help manufacturers in Southeast Wisconsin grow their companies.


 


Michael Quill brings 20 years of experience in new product development, market research and marketing planning to his new position of marketing specialist.  His primary area of focus will be working with small and midsize manufacturers in Kenosha and Racine. 


 


“We know that growth is an area that many small manufacturers are struggling with today,” said Quill.  “For some companies growth can come from new markets, while for others it comes from increasing business with current customers.  WMEP is an excellent resource to help manufacturers develop strategies to achieve profitable growth,” he said.


 


Before joining WMEP, Quill served as product manager for Waukesha-based Smiths Medical PM, Inc., a leading global provider of medical devices; and as senior marketing manager for a Racine-based industrial consumer safety products firm.  Throughout his career, Quill has created marketing plans, managed new product launches, planned and executed market research and developed new business opportunities that led to sales and revenue growth.


 


A Racine resident, Quill holds a master’s degree in business administration from DePaul University with a concentration in marketing and a bachelor of arts degree from the University of Notre Dame. 


 


“Planning for growth is a critical element of Next Generation Manufacturing,” Quill said.  Next Generation Manufacturers are firms that are lean and agile, innovative, globally-focused, environmentally aware and able to attract and retain skilled workers.  


 


WMEP’s growth and business development services include: Eureka! Winning Ways, a nationally recognized approach to smarter growth; market research and analysis; marketing plans; strategic business planning and go-to-market channel planning.

ABOUT WMEP


WMEP is a private, nonprofit organization committed to the growth and success of Wisconsin manufacturers, and to helping them make the transition to Next Generation Manufacturing.  Since 1996, WMEP’s experts have helped more than 2,500 small and midsize manufacturers improve profitability and productivity.  WMEP is a leader in lean manufacturing, growth services, strategic business planning, quality systems and supplier development.  During the past five years, WMEP-assisted manufacturers reported economic impact of $839 million with more than 8,000 jobs created/retained.  WMEP receives financial support from the Wisconsin Department of Commerce, and partners with many public and private organizations to serve Wisconsin manufacturers.
